The winners of the reward challenge this week were picked up by a boat and sent to a spot where they received breakfast in bed. Also, the winners got to decide who was sent to Exile Island, but there was a new twist this time…one person from each losing team would be sent to Exile Island. Aras, Bruce and Sally, the winners of the reward challenge, sent Austin and Danielle to Exile Island.
When the boat arrived to take Aras, Bruce and Sally to their reward they were shocked to see a big bed sitting on a sandbar. What was so shocking? The bed was soaked from the heavy downpour. But what made matter worse was they too were soaked. However, when the basket of food arrived they felt better as they stuffed themselves till they were full. In my opinion, a soaking wet bed is not much of a reward.
The rain put a damper on everyone. They were all miserable from the rain. They couldn't build a fire, and as a result, the only thing they had to do was huddle together in their shelter; they were all cold and wet.
Terry told Sally he had the idol. What was he thinking! I would have NEVER breathed a word about it. I guess he really trusted Sally. If there's one thing that's always said in this game it is, "never trust anyone!"
It looks as if Terry is carrying out part of my strategy, because for the second time in a row he has won Individual Immunity. He's been fighting hard to win the individual Immunities when he knows he needs it, and he's hanging on to the secret Immunity in the process. The only thing he's done wrong, so far, is he told Sally that he found the secret Immunity Idol.
But wait, now he's really blown my strategy...he decided to also tell Austin that he found the secret Immunity Idol. However, it didn't end there either. The next person Terry decided to trust was Danielle, and he showed the Idol to her. Not only did Terry show Danielle the Idol, but he also offered to give it to her if she would join their little tribe.
